Chargers TE Antonio Gates says 'It'd be difficult' to play in week 4

Here we go again. San Diego Chargers tight end Antonio Gates @AntonioGates85, according to his own words, is unlikely to play this weekend against the Miami Dolphins. Gates, who didn't practice Wednesday, told Kevin Acee of the San Diego Union-Tribune that even with four days until kickoff, "it'd be difficult" for him to play because of his foot injuries. Gates didn't play in last week's win versus Kansas City.

Fantasy Analysis:

If Gates is out for another week -- and it sure sounds like he will be -- Randy McMichael @randymac81 would take over his starting spot once again. But he's not really that valuable in fantasy since he's a blocker more than anything else. If you need a replacement, players such as Greg Olsen, Scott Chandler, Brandon Pettigrew and/or Fred Davis should be available in some leagues. Even deeper, I don't mind the likes of Jermaine Gresham or Ed Dickson. They are all better bets than McMichael.
